Mallesons Acts on Breakthrough Agribusiness Deal

Mallesons Stephen Jaques, a leading law firm in the Asian region, has acted for HRZ Wheats Pty Ltd on a significant deal enabling the continued investment in the creation of unique germplasm targeting the high rainfall zone of Australia, following an equity investment into the company by Dow AgroSciences Australia Ltd.

HRZ Wheat’s other shareholders are CSIRO, the Grains Research and Development Corporation, Landmark Operations Limited and New Zealand Plant & Food Research.

The investment by Dow AgroSciences, one of Australia’s leading agricultural chemical and pest control companies that also has a strong emphasis on agricultural crops, will enable HRZ Wheats to continue to develop milling quality, disease resistant wheat varieties with a high rate of return for the nation’s growers, overcoming the challenges presented by the high rainfall zone. The deal will ensure leading technologies and new germplasm for research and breeding will be made available to HRZ Wheats. Landmark (through Seednet and partners) will be responsible for the seed production and commercialisation of commodity wheat varieties within Australia.
